About
Petter I Pankinaho is a Swedish Trumpet player and composer that explores the contemporary jazz landscape with a clear focus on sound and interplay. Petter moves freely between tonal colors, improvisation, and pulsating grooves.
The music balances structure and freedom, guided by curiosity and presence. With elements of Scandinavian free jazz woven into his sound, and inspiration drawn from both nordic lyricism and modern improvisational music, he creates an expression that is organic, exploratory, and deeply rooted in the present moment.
“Petter I Pankinaho presents some of the melodies with a rich trumpet tone and is also given space for some beautifully crafted solos – somewhat in the style of the trumpeter Ron Miles.” - Orkesterjournalen (Jazz magazine)
Pankinaho has studied music three years in Sweden, at University of music and drama and and 6 months in Paris where he discovered the rich and international jazz scene and met one of his biggest inspirations, Ambrose Akinmsuire. Later he became a member of the Betty Carter jazz ahead Program where he met like-minded musicians and mentors.
Collaboration and Grants
● -2022 He participated in a collaboration with the Kennedy Center in Washington D.C in USA. Which was led by pianist Jason Moran. He performed two concerts of his original music at the J.F. Kennedy Center.
● 2022 He had the honour to go to Washington D.C in the USA and play my original music at the Kennedy Center in connection with a project called Betty Carter Jazz Ahead. This was sponsored by the Kennedy Center. It was for musicians and composers who have a desire to develop jazz music as an art form.
● 2022 He participated in a workshop together with award-winning choreographer Hope Boykin and composer Jason Moran. He did two collaborations with dancers led by Hope Boykins where they explored improvisation as a basic element within both art forms. This was performed at the Kennedy Center.
● 2022 He was hired as a musician in Louis Bonilla's big band. He toured for two weeks in Croatia and Italy together with Dick Oats And Alex Sipiagin.
● 2019 He played a concert together with guitarist Kurt Rosenwinkel in Paris at the Conservatoire national Supérieur de Musique et de Danse de Paris.
● He participated as a soloist at Vara Konserthus and Nefertiti jazz club together with Bohuslän Big band. We also recorded an album at Nilento studio where I was a soloist, arranger and composer. 2020
● He received a scholarship from Vänersborg's sons' guild in 2018 for his trumpet playing.
